Hi Guys,

I have a 2008 G6ET and I am still loving it.

I was just wondering has anyone modified the exhaust at all, either for better sound or performance?

Any suggestions as to what should be done and also will this void warranty at all?

Cheers

What I did was cut the factory muffler off & got a 3" cannon muffler welded on. Also had twin chrome tips out the back.. Very, very happy with the results.. Deep note, with no droaning.. When you press the load pedal... wow !!!!

I will be interested in the price you get it for.... My mod cost $300.00.. they done a real neat job too.. I bought a rear section & had that modded, so I can put the stock one back on @ a later date when I change the car over :blush:
